
The episode discusses the transition from being a high performer to a generous leader and how this shift impacts communication and decision-making.
I want to talk about the shift that happens when someone moves from being rewarded for being right to being trusted to lead. That is a real transition, and it changes the way you use your strengths, your communication, and your judgment. The goal is not to become less capable. The goal is to become more useful to the people around you. A lot of high performers get promoted because they know the answer, move quickly, and stay precise. But leadership asks for something different.
